ICE HOTEL

Greetings from the Ice Hotel!

When we arrived for a tour we were able to see how the ice blocks were made from the Torne river, how the hotel is constructed new each year from solid river ice, though it melts by the end of April. There's of a chapel where weddings are held, suites and rooms of ice with beds of ice, the Absolute Bar, a gift shop and lodge. Many of the rooms are unique with ice sculptures and carvings on themes,

At the Absolute Bar, vodka is served in a clear ice glass that chills the drink while you are sipping it. The entire glass is made of ice with a whole bored in the center. The amazing part is that your lips do not freeze to the glass and it is comfortable and refreshing to drink right from the ice glass.
